Abstract

Missionary attrition together with the problem of institutional child sexual abuse in the Church has highlighted the importance of a standardized psychological assessment process for mission and ministry candidates. This scoping review aimed to examine peer-reviewed publications, from 2001 to 2021, which focused on the psychological assessment of ministry and cross-cultural mission candidates, to find knowledge gaps that exist. Using scoping review guidelines, 6,739 references were identified and 2,476 duplicates were removed. A further 4,254 references were excluded because they did not meet screening criteria.
